Introduction to Google Quantum AI
Google Quantum AI is dedicated to building a large, error-corrected quantum computer. This mission is driven by a multidisciplinary team that provides the strategic direction necessary to catalyze the full-stack development of quantum systems. The team comprises researchers, engineers, and technicians with diverse backgrounds and expertise, all striving to weave together their distinct perspectives to cultivate creativity and foster innovation.
The Google Quantum AI team is structured into several key areas:
- Hardware Team: Focuses on the research, development, and deployment of the entire quantum system, from processor fabrication and packaging to other essential components.
- Quantum Computer Scientists and Software Engineers: Develop novel algorithms for both near-term "NISQ" devices and future error-corrected processors. They also concentrate on quantum error correction theory and software for building fault-tolerant quantum computers.
- Physical Analysis and Numerical Modeling: Combines these techniques to gain a deep understanding of quantum systems, from individual components to their large-scale behavior.
- Operations Function: Works collectively with researchers and engineers to deliver products and programs essential for realizing the mission of building a large error-corrected quantum computer.

Specific Internship Opportunity: Research Intern, PhD, Summer 2026
A specific example of an internship opportunity is the "Research Intern, PhD, Summer 2026" position. This is a full-time internship lasting 12-14 weeks.

Responsibilities
The responsibilities of a Research Intern include:
- Developing and executing a clear research agenda.
- Collaborating with team members, managers, and partner groups to deliver results.
- Designing experiments, prototypes, and system architectures.
- Contributing to advancing research in AI, machine perception, networking, storage, quantum information science, and related areas.
- Sharing outcomes through publications and open-source contributions where applicable.
Qualifications
To be eligible for the Research Intern position, candidates must:
- Be currently enrolled in a PhD program in Computer Science, Statistics, Biostatistics, Linguistics, Applied Mathematics, Operations Research, Economics, Natural Sciences, or a related technical field.
- Have experience in at least one area of computer science, such as machine learning, natural language understanding, deep learning, optimization, quantum information science, or data science.
Preferred qualifications include:

- Being in the penultimate academic year or returning to a degree program after the internship.
- Availability to work full-time for 12 weeks in the US outside of university term time.
- Prior research experience (internships, labs, publications).
- Contributions to research communities, including published work in top journals or conferences.
- Proficiency in one or more general-purpose programming languages (Python, Java, JavaScript, C/C++, etc.).
Compensation and Benefits
The US base salary range for the internship is $113,000-$150,000, pro-rated for the internship duration. Additional benefits include professional development, mentorship, and networking opportunities. Note that the compensation does not include bonus, equity, or other benefits.
Application Instructions
Applications are reviewed on a rolling basis, and it is recommended to apply early, as the application window may close before February 27, 2026, if projects are filled. Required materials include:
- Updated CV or resume (with anticipated graduation date).
- Current unofficial or official transcript in English.
Applications must be submitted online through Google Careers. Participation requires being physically located in the US for the duration of the internship.
